Studying at DHBW Heilbronn
Heilbronn is the economic center of the Heilbronn-Franken region and belongs to Stuttgart metropolitan region. It is home to numerous global leaders and dynamic innovations. Established in 2010, the DHBW campus in Heilbronn is the newest campus of Baden-Wuerttemberg-Cooperative State University. You will study in an economically and culturally vibrant city on a modern campus with state-of-the-art facilities located in the center.
